Today there are about 15 A-3’s in storage at the AMARC facility.  We are diligently working to place all Skywarriors in museums to honor the crews and maintainers who operated the A-3.  First one pictured is a Vapper RA-3B.
It is very costly to move one of these aircraft from storage to a museum and could take years to raise funds and get the necessary approvals.

Mojave Airport in California (near Palmdale and EAFB)

There are four A-3’s stored at Mojave that are held in reserve for Flight Test.  These aircraft are under the control of Raytheon Flight Operations and NAVAIR.  If you are up at Mojave you can go to the control tower and find the security guard. Usually the guard will drive you out to see these A-3s..

NAS Lakehurst, New Jersey
NA-3B
BuNo 138922   FEWSG Bird

(dateline 5/3/04) They originally had 2 Skywarriors.   One was being transferred to a museum somewhere in New Jersey by a helicopter sky crane. It broke loose and dropped the Whale in the woods totaling it out..............this was about 12 years ago.  The last Skywarrior they had was scrapped/destroyed because the environmentalists in the area were concerned about pollution off of the old aircraft. So Skywarrior #138922 is no more
